Anna Mae Eyer (Goldsmith)

Anna Mae Goldsmith, 81, formerly of West Salem, Ill., passed away Sunday, March 25, 2007, at Rest Haven Manor in Albion.

Anna Mae was born March 22, 1926, in Olney, Ill., to Asher and Audrey (Worthey) Eyer. She married Lowell Goldsmith Jr. on Nov. 27, 1947, in Olney.

During their 46 years of marriage they owned and operated Goldsmith's Paint and Wallpaper store in Olney and Goldsmith's Home Furniture store in West Salem. Anna Mae was a member of Zion United Methodist Church in West Salem. One of her greatest joys was singing, providing music for plays, radio shows, weddings, church and funerals.
